Tennessee's two venomous snake species found in the Smokies are the timber rattlesnake and the northern copperhead. If bitten by any snake, you should call 911 and seek immediate medical attention.
Louisiana is home to seven venomous snake species, including three species of rattlesnake. The three species found in Louisiana include the Eastern diamondback, timber and Pygmy rattlesnakes.
